There is a new record on it's way!!
Yes, Tommy has started work on a new release
of original music that should be ready for release in early 2010. The
project is being produced and engineered by Brian Joseph Dobbs who is an up
and coming producer who has been involved in the recording industry for more
than 20 years. Brian spent a decade working with Canadian high profile
producer Bob Rock as a studio engineer and technician working with many of
the music businesses top acts like Metallica, Bon Jovi, Tal Bachman, AC/DC
and American HiFi to name just a few of the biggest! He is now concentrating
on producing great songs for many Canadian and American independent artists
who have gone on to receive much airplay, record and publishing deals, tours
and management contracts. All very exciting for us!

November 5/08
"Jack And The Letters Home," the new
single from the Wheels of Life CD has risen to #79 on the November CanCon
chart after only a few weeks of release.
The single coincides with Remembrance Day to
pay tribute to our brave soldier past and present and all they've done to
keep us safe and free.
The song is written through the eyes of a young
boy as he watches his older brother, his hero, go off to war and follows his
every escaped through his letters home.
The track was released on DMDS to
Canadian country radio on Monday October 6, 2008 by RDR Music Group and
Lauren Tutty Promotions.

Tommy, Brad and Rob back from Montana!
"It was a memorable experience" says Tommy John
Ehman of their excursion to Montana to record with the legendary Garry
Tallent of the E Street Band. "Garry couldn't have been more gracious
and professional and his work on the album was quite simply, amazing."
Dubbed "The Montana Sessions," the trip
produced some great memories, friendships and as well 11 stunning bass
tracks for the new album. Over the course of two very busy days in April,
Garry layed down track after track of innovative and intriguing bass guitar.
His years of experience with Bruce Springsteen and countless studio
endeavors, showed through with "tight," professional work. Garry also
expressed a keen interest in the songs and commented on several occasions
that he thought the material was very strong, which means a lot coming from
a man who has played with 'The Boss" for over 30 years!
Garry and the three "Saskatchewan boys" worked
very well together in the studio and also enjoyed each others company over
lunches and coffee where a true friendship was formed.
"I'm looking forward to next time already. I
would love to work with Garry again and I hope we do!"
